Panshanger is a neighbourhood in Hertfordshire with a population of 9,152. The median property price is £390,000, with 206 sales in the last year and prices rising 8.0 per cent over five years.

Terraced homes are most common, with a median price of £405,125; detached properties command £625,000. The median age is 41.9 years, and 59.6 per cent of homes are owner-occupied. About 65 per cent of neighbourhoods in England are more deprived than here. A third of residents aged 16 and over hold level 4 qualifications or above. Air quality is moderate, with no flood risk in the area. Broadband is widely available: 98.6 per cent superfast coverage and 92.2 per cent ultrafast. Welwyn Hatfield Borough Council administers the area, with a band D council tax of £2,390.19.
